The Hwange local Board is courting investors for the construction of a 5 star hotel as the resort town seeks to boost tourism.
Hwange Local Board town secretary Ndumiso Mdlalose said a site visit for the 22 500 square metres of land where the hotel would be constructed was planned for September 19.
He said the local board had identified a site with good scenery.
The land is on a mountain and will overlook the proposed civic centre site for Hwange town.
The local authority was allocated $600 000 by the Finance ministry last year to spruce up its infrastructure ahead of the 20th session of the United Nations World Tourism Organisation General Assembly.
